Sharon Ann Wyse, L.Ac.

 

Sharon Ann Wyse is a New York State Licensed Acupuncturist and a

Certified Chinese herbalist. She is a Board Certified Diplomate of

Acupuncture and Chinese Herbology through the National Certification

Commission for Acupuncture and Oriental Medicine.

 

Sharon received her Master's degree in 2003 from The New York College

of Health Professions where her studies included Acupuncture, Chinese

herbal medicine, Acupressure and AMMA massage, T'ai Chi Chuan and Qi

gong. While in school she worked full time at the college's herbal

dispensary where she provided patient education regarding herbal

formulations.

 

Upon graduation Sharon went on to work at Columbia University

facilitating two NIH funded clinical research studies testing the

efficacy of Acupuncture and Moxibustion on HIV+ related symptoms.

Sharon is a certified volunteer for Acupuncturists Without Borders

(AWB) and a member of the Acupuncture Society of New York (ASNY). She

also serves as a Clean Needle Technique Examiner for the Council of

Colleges in Acupuncture and Oriental Medicine.

 

Sharon's philosophical approach to treatment includes a strong

emphasis on patient education. She encourages patients to actively

participate in the healing process and often incorporates lifestyle

changes and herbal medicine in her treatment plans. She maintains a

strong commitment to the promotion of the integration of Eastern and

Western medicine as a future medical model within our health care

system. Specialized areas of interest include women's health, stress

management, addictions, digestive and bowel disorders, insomnia, and

the treatment of sinus and allergy problems.
